🚦 upgate

The gate between available and ready updates

A new version can be available before it is ready for your system. upgate waits for the configured release age, applies the version policy, and checks OSV when it can identify the exact package. You see the result and choose what gets updated.

Package managers still find and install updates in their own way. upgate checks the possible updates before it runs their commands. This makes supply chain attacks harder, but still it cannot prove that a release is safe.

Install

Download the prebuilt binary for your system from the latest release. Unpack it and place upgate in a directory from your PATH. Rust is not required.

Build with Cargo

To build upgate from source, you need Rust 1.88 or newer.

cargo install upgate

Build the current source

git clone https://github.com/podkovyrin/upgate.git
cd upgate
cargo install --path crates/upgate-cli --locked

macOS is the main platform today. Linux is supported too, but it has not had the same amount of real-world testing yet.

Start here

upgate

This command scans installed tools, builds an update plan, and opens the interactive picker. The picker shows current tools, available updates, and anything delayed, blocked, or failed. Choose the updates you want, then run them from the picker.

For read-only checks and other workflows:

# List installed tools
upgate scan

# Build a plan without updating anything
upgate plan

# Run only selected package managers
upgate plan --managers npm,cargo

# Preview the commands without running them
upgate apply --dry-run

# Apply the default selection without opening the picker
upgate apply --yolo

Add --verbose when you need release-age, version-policy, or security details.

Supported package managers

Defaults and supported features differ by manager.

Package manager Default mode Minimum release age Version policies OSV check
Homebrew apply 12 hours none, stable, same-track When the Git source is known
Bun apply 7 days none, stable, same-track npm
Cargo apply 7 days none, stable, same-track crates.io
npm apply 7 days none, stable, same-track npm
mise apply 7 days none Known backend or Git source
pipx apply 7 days none, stable, same-track PyPI
pnpm apply 7 days none, stable, same-track npm
uv apply 7 days none PyPI
Go apply 7 days none, stable, same-track Go
RubyGems off 7 days stable RubyGems
.NET tools off 7 days none, stable, same-track NuGet

The OSV column shows where package identity comes from. A check runs only when upgate can make an exact mapping. Missing package-manager executables are skipped.

Configuration

The config file is $XDG_CONFIG_HOME/upgate/config.toml, or ~/.config/upgate/config.toml when XDG_CONFIG_HOME is not set. Without a config file, upgate uses the defaults above.

[npm]
min_release_age = "14d"
version_policy = "same-track"

[npm.selection]
mode = "skip"
except = ["typescript"]

[gem]
mode = "plan"

Manager mode can be:

  • apply: include the manager in every command
  • plan: scan and plan, but do not update
  • off: skip the manager

A selection rule controls the default package selection. except always means the opposite of mode. The example skips npm packages by default, except for typescript.

Release age accepts seconds, minutes, hours, and days, such as 30m, 12h, or 7d. npm accepts whole days only.

Version policy can be:

  • none: do not filter prereleases
  • stable: use final releases only
  • same-track: stay at least as stable as the installed version

Not every policy fits every manager. Unsupported combinations are rejected. See the full config example for every setting.

Use --set or -S for one run:

upgate plan --set npm.min_release_age=14d --set brew.no_update=true

Release age and security

A version younger than min_release_age is not selected by the normal plan. When a manager provides version history, an older eligible version can be used instead. Waiting gives problems time to become visible. It is not proof that a release is safe.

OSV checks run only for packages with an exact ecosystem and package identity. For those packages, a vulnerable target or a failed OSV request is blocked by default. Packages without an OSV mapping are shown without an audit result and are not blocked.

The interactive picker can offer a forced target for some blocked updates. When that option is present, you can choose it explicitly.

upgate scan --verbose audits installed versions. Normal scan does not contact OSV.
